    Why is my CASO DESIGN VC350 not creating a complete vacuum in the bag?

      If your CASO DESIGN Food Saver isn't creating a complete vacuum, it might be due to a few reasons. First, ensure the open end of the bag is entirely within the vacuum chamber; proper positioning is key. If the bag is positioned correctly and you still experience issues, the bag itself may be defective, so try using another bag. Also, check the welding and seals for any residue; if present, clean them and ensure they are completely dry before attempting again.

    What to do if CASO DESIGN VC350 Food Saver bag does not hold vacuum after sealing?

      If your CASO DESIGN Food Saver bag doesn't hold the vacuum after sealing, the bag may be defective, so try another one and wrap paper around any sharp edges inside the bag. Alternatively, leaks may occur along the welding seam due to creases, crumbs, grease, or liquids. Reopen the bag, clean the upper internal part, and remove any foreign matter from the welding bar before resealing.

    Why is my CASO DESIGN VC350 Food Saver not sealing the bag correctly?

      If your CASO DESIGN Food Saver isn't sealing bags correctly, the sealing bar might be overheating, causing the bag to melt. Open the cover and let the unit cool down for a few minutes. Ensure you are using only specified bags and rolls. Also, ensure the roll or bag is positioned correctly.
